The Cheaters (Al-Mutaffifeen)
36 verses, revealed in Mecca after The Spider (Al-Ankaboot) before The Heifer (Al-Baqarah)
In the Name of God, the Merciful, the Compassionate
Woe to those who give short measure, 1 those who demand a full measure from others 2 But if they give by measure or by weight to them, they cause loss. 3 Do they not realise that they will be raised to life 4 On a grievous day, 5 The day on which men shall stand before the Lord of the worlds? 6 Nay! Surely the record of the wicked is (preserved) in Sijjin. 7 And what will make you know what the Sijjin is? 8 A Register inscribed. 9 Woe, that Day, to the deniers, 10 who belied the Day of Recompense! 11 No one denies it except for the evil aggressor. 12 And when Our revelations are rehearsed unto him, he saith: fables of the ancients! 13 Not at all but rather their earnings have heaped rust upon their hearts. 14 On the Day of Judgment, they will certainly be barred from the mercy of their Lord. 15 and then, behold, they shall enter the blazing fire 16 Then it shall be said to them, 'This is that you cried lies to.' 17 However, the records of the deeds of the virtuous ones will certainly be in Illiyin. 18 What could let you know what the 'Illiyoon is! 19 (There is) a Register (fully) inscribed, 20 Which is witnessed by those brought near [to Allah]. 21 Most surely the righteous shall be in bliss, 22 On thrones, watching. 23 and in their faces you shall know the radiance of bliss. 24 They will be given to drink pure sealed wine. 25 whose seal is musk -- so after that let the strivers strive -- 26 and whose mixture is Tasnim, 27 A spring from which those near [to Allah] drink. 28 Verily those who have sinned were wont at those who had believed to laugh, 29 when them passed them by winking at one another, 30 And when they returned to their own people, they would return jesting; 31 And when they saw them, they said: Most surely these are in error; 32 No one has appointed them to watch over the believers. 33 But this Day (the Day of Resurrection) those who believe will laugh at the disbelievers 34 while reclining on couches and reviewing (the bounties given to them). 35 Have the unbelievers been rewarded what they were doing? 36
True are the words of Allah the Almighty.
End of Surah: The Cheaters (Al-Mutaffifeen). Sent down in Mecca after The Spider (Al-Ankaboot) before The Heifer (Al-Baqarah)

How does the memorization exercise algorithm work? At the lowest level 0, all words are visible. While the highest level 9 hides all words. What about at mid-level, like 3, for example? You might think that the algorithm hides precisely 3 out of every nine words. Not quite! At level 3, each word has a 3 out of 9 chance to hide, and 6 out of 9 to be visible. In other words, it is possible, but highly unlikely, for all words at level 3 to be hidden, or, that all of them to be visible! Also, at mid-levels, and in proportion to the difficulty level, hideouts can be partially incomplete or transparent so that words may be partially visible underneath.
